  • Coverage of European Languages by ISO Latin Alphabetsweb page

    This document shows which of the Latin alphabets No. 1 through 10 (as defined by ISO 8859) are necessary in order to cover all the required characters for a number of European languages.

    Author Jukka "Yucca" Korpela
